HD74LVC1G32
2–input OR Gate
Description
REJ03D0010–0300Z
Rev.3.00
Jul. 01.2004
The HD74LVC1G32 has two–input OR gate in a 5-pin package. Low voltage and high-speed operation is suitable for
the battery powered products (e.g., notebook computers), and the low power consumption extends the battery life.
Features
The basic gate function is lined up as renesas uni logic series.
Supply voltage range: 1.65 to 5.5 V
Operating temperature range: –40 to +85°C
All inputs: VIH (Max.) = 5.5 V (@VCC = 0 V to 5.5 V)
All outputs: VO (Max.) = 5.5 V (@VCC = 0 V)
Output current:
±4 mA (@VCC = 1.65 V)
±8 mA (@VCC = 2.3 V)
±24 mA (@VCC = 3.0 V)
±32 mA (@VCC = 4.5 V)

Notes:
The absolute maximum ratings are values, which must not individually be exceeded, and furthermore no two
of which may be realized at the same time.
1. The input and output voltage ratings may be exceeded if the input and output clamp-current ratings are
observed.
2. This value is limited to 5.5 V maximum.
